Watch a live coverage as SpaceX launches a Falcon 9 rocket from California with 28 optimized Starlink v2 Mini internet satellites. Liftoff from Space Launch Complex 4E (SLC-4E) at Vandenberg Space Force Base is scheduled for Friday, Oct. 31, at 1:41 p.m. PDT (4:41 p.m. EDT / 2041 UTC).
The first-stage booster, tail number B1063, making its 29th flight, will land on the drone ship 'Of Course I Still Love You' nearly 8.5 minutes into the flight.
The Starlink 11-23 mission trajectory will hug the coast of California, following a south-easterly path upon departure from Vandenberg.
